原文:全备+binlog方式将数据库恢复至指定位置

生产环境中会出现误删数据,使用增备又无法恢复到指定位置。可以通过全备 binlog server方式将数据库恢复至指定位置。 环境描述: .将 实例全备,apply好的数据拷贝到数据库: .启动 实例并查看zhangshuo库: .将 实例binlog文件拷贝到新实例 并查找到误删数据的起始位置: 可以看到误删数据begin位置 和commit位置 . .在新实例 zhangshuo库中将数据恢复 ...

2016-07-26 18:26 0 1866 推荐指数:

查看详情

从mysql 导入指定数据库数据:三种考虑方法

起因: 公司数据库改造,需要将原有多个数据库恢复到新的服务器上,DBA同事提供给我的其他来源数据库备份均为。但是要求并不是恢复至新服务器。 mysql版本:5.6.43-log ---------------- 处理过程: 在这个前提下尝试了三种方法恢复: 注意:在导入前 ...

Thu Aug 01 23:41:00 CST 2019 0 1074
MySQL+binlog恢复方法之伪装master【原创】

利用mysql +binlog server恢复方法之伪装master 单实例试验 一、试验环境 10.72.7.40 实例 mysql3306为要恢复的对象,mysql3306的+binlog server(目录/data/mysql/mysql3306/backup) 实例 ...

Thu Aug 16 21:04:00 CST 2018 0 856
MySQL数据库的冷方式

MySQL数据库备份的冷方式最为简单,指在数据库停止的情况下,一般只复制数据库相关物理文件即可。 对于InnoDB存储引擎的表,只需要备份MySQL数据库的frm文件,共享表空间文件,独立表空间文件,重做日志文件。 另外,需定期备份MySQL数据库的配置文件my.cnf,这样有利于恢复的操作 ...

Thu Jun 18 02:11:00 CST 2020 0 761
mysql-binlog日志恢复数据库

binlog日志用于记录所有更新了数据或者已经潜在更新了数据的所有语句。语句以“事件”的形式保存,它描述数据更改。当我们因为某种原因导致数据库出现故障时,就可以利用binlog日志来挽回(前提是已经配置好了binlog),接下来我们来配置 一、开启mysql-binlog日志 在mysql ...

Mon Feb 22 06:45:00 CST 2016 1 33320
oracle数据库中的备份和恢复及例子

手工热(开状态) 备份控制文件: alter database backup controlfile to '/u01/oradata/prod/con.bak1'; 备份数据文件(这里用到pl/sql进行批处理,将查询结果粘贴运行即可) beginfor i in (select ...

Tue Nov 14 01:47:00 CST 2017 0 2448
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M